SLIDE 23

S SPECIFIC

Can you easily state your goal?

M MEASURABLE

How will you know when you’ve reached your goal?

A

ATTAINABLE

Can your goal be accomplished?

R

REALISTIC

Is your goal too difficult to reach? Too easy?

T

TIMELY

When will you complete this goal by?

  • Keep them few in number
  • Make them SMART
  • Write them down
  • Review them frequently
  • Share them selectively

GOAL SETTING TIPS
